As the Ligi kuu Bara season progresses, Mbeya City prepares to host Mtibwa Sugar at the Sokoine Stadium on June 13, 2026. This clash is set against the backdrop of both teams striving to improve their standings, with Mbeya City currently sitting in 14th place, while Mtibwa Sugar holds the 12th position.

Mbeya City enters this match after a mixed set of results, having secured only one win in their last five matches. They recently suffered a heavy 4-1 defeat against Singida Black Stars, underscoring their defensive vulnerabilities. However, a narrow 2-1 win against Tanzania Prisons showed they can find the back of the net when needed. At home, their form has been inconsistent, with one win, two draws, and two losses. Their average of 0.80 goals scored per game at home suggests a struggle in attack, while conceding 1.60 goals on average highlights their defensive challenges. Notably, Mbeya City has a full squad available with no injuries or suspensions affecting their lineup.

Mtibwa Sugar, on the other hand, has also faced a turbulent run, with just one win in their last five outings. Their recent 2-2 draw with JKT Tanzania displayed resilience, but a heavy 4-0 loss to Singida Black Stars emphasized their defensive frailties. Away from home, Mtibwa Sugar has struggled significantly, failing to secure any wins and managing only one draw in their last five away games. They have scored an average of 0.60 goals per match on the road while conceding 2.40, indicating a leaky defense. Similar to Mbeya City, Mtibwa Sugar faces no injury or suspension issues, allowing them to field their strongest available lineup.

With both teams showing defensive weaknesses and a penchant for conceding goals, this match could see both sides finding the net. The prediction leans towards "All: Both Teams to Score : Yes" as a likely outcome. This is supported by the fact that both teams have scored in their previous head-to-head encounters, including a 2-2 draw. Given the current form and scoring patterns of both teams, it seems probable that they will each manage to score in this fixture.
